Anyone else BB not working in BN14 area?
My 20Meg service seems to have dropped out at 7:23 this morning. There have been a large number of dropouts over the last 4 weeks (some short and some not so short). Called VM but they just arranged an engineer and said nothing was broken at their end. They didn't even get me to go through the usual things that we all do before calling them anyway.
My CM sync light is just flashing its heart out and if I stick a laptop on it then it give the laptop a 90 second lease with a 192.168.100.x address. I even tried my old CM and that won't sync either.
Anyone else having issues in this area?
